**Trapped in a Psych Ward: A Digital Age Dilemma**

Imagine being trapped in a psych ward, surrounded by sterile white walls and the constant hum of fluorescent lights. It’s bad enough to be dealing with mental health issues, but when you’re stuck behind bars, both figuratively and literally, it can feel like a never-ending nightmare.

In today’s digital age, technology has become an integral part of our daily lives. We rely on smartphones, tablets, and computers to stay connected, work, and access information. But what happens when these tools are taken away from us?

As someone who’s been confined to a psych ward, you’re not just struggling with your mental health; you’re also grappling with the loss of control over your digital life. Your phone, tablet, or computer is gone, leaving you feeling disconnected and isolated.

The anxiety and frustration can be overwhelming. You may feel like you’re stuck in limbo, unable to communicate with loved ones or access essential information. The constant fear of being forgotten or left behind can drive you crazy.

But there’s hope. Many psych wards now recognize the importance of digital communication and have implemented measures to help patients stay connected. Some hospitals offer tablets or laptops for patients to use during their stay, allowing them to stay in touch with family and friends, access online therapy resources, and even work remotely.

For those without access to these tools, there are still ways to stay connected. Patients can use paper and pen to write letters or draw pictures, which can be a therapeutic outlet as well. Alternatively, some psych wards offer phone booths or designated areas where patients can make calls using payphones.

The digital age has brought many benefits, but it’s also highlighted the need for greater understanding and empathy towards those struggling with mental health issues. By recognizing the importance of technology in our lives and taking steps to accommodate these needs, we can help create a more inclusive and supportive environment for those seeking treatment.

Ultimately, being trapped in a psych ward is never easy. But by embracing digital tools and finding creative ways to stay connected, you can find solace in the midst of chaos.
